The Supreme Court denied certiorari in the case of Saenz-Mendoza v. United States, declining to review a decision from the Tenth Circuit Court of Appeals. The case involved a criminal defendant, Saenz-Mendoza, who had been convicted in federal district court and unsuccessfully appealed that conviction to the Tenth Circuit.
